Francis Whitaker

Francis Whitaker (1906 - October 3, 1999) was a famous blacksmith in Carmel, California and, later, an artist-in-residence at the Colorado Rocky Mountain School in Carbondale, CO.

He was born in Woburn, Massachusetts and died in Glenwood Springs, Colorado.

In 1995, he received the Colorado Council on the Arts Governor's Award for Excellence in the Arts. In 1997, he received the National Heritage Fellowship from the National Endowment for the Arts.
